Computer Science

A college degree in computer science can provide you with the skills you need for a successful career in the technology field. One of the most important skills you will learn is logical thinking. This skill is critical for solving problems and programming. In order to program a computer, you need to be able to think logically. You need to be able to break down a problem into smaller parts and figure out the best way to solve it. This involves a lot of trial and error, and you need to be able to think logically to figure out what is causing a problem and how to fix it. Logical thinking is also important for debugging. Debugging is the process of finding and fixing errors in code. This can be a difficult task, and you need to be able to think logically to track down the source of the error and fix it. Finally, logical thinking is important for developing algorithms. Algorithms are the step-by-step instructions that computers use to solve problems. You need to be able to think logically to develop algorithms that are efficient and effective.
